Transaction 2cdcd83cb41737002f324a1e2b5ba16f9be62ba568545c1823909236c765e521
2 Input
2 Outputs
- 2cdcd83cb41737002f324a1e2b5ba16f9be62ba568545c1823909236c765e521:0
- 2cdcd83cb41737002f324a1e2b5ba16f9be62ba568545c1823909236c765e521:1
value 181894
address 39rdFXoFuRKrdwdFS5BMVqeew3h4GbgV1N
value 3219051
address 172u41YZuZHWE2DfAnDRp3fiH99pZ56ZSs